Patient undergoing hyperbaric oxygen therapy is loaded into a pressurised one-man chamber, where he will be treated for over two hours with pure oxygen at twice atmospheric pressure. Hyperbaric oxygen therapy (HBOT) is the medical use of oxygen at pressure higher than normal atmospheric pressure and is used to treat wounds and ulceration, as well as carbon monoxide poisoning and decompression sickness.
